I hope he feels better. I don't want to sound like a broken record, did you bump your temps up like others suggested. I was just curious if he ever got diagnosed by a vet. I know vets can be expensive. But if he doesn't start showing any signs of improvement soon, if you haven't done so already I would bump his temps up, and try to find a vet. Better to catch it early. If you caught it early enough, bumping up the temp should help. I could not agree with you more, vets are incredibly expensive. But on the flip side, just like any other pet, or people for that matter, there may come a time their needs may surpass the care we can offer. And if a vet is needed, it is our responsibility to make sure that care is provided. If you do in fact end up having to go to a vet, there are a lot more experienced people than me who could tell you the questions to ask, and the things to have done and not done. Keep us posted.
